Output 08bfaa31c23d02261c795e046c8e4daee87eae7c52312528bfb815dfd1173e3e:1

value
5695399
script pubkey
OP_0 OP_PUSHBYTES_20 097b65c9421e218478956da57dfee602d8163371
address
bc1qp9aktj2zrcscg7y4dkjhmlhxqtvpvvm3nd9wmw
transaction
08bfaa31c23d02261c795e046c8e4daee87eae7c52312528bfb815dfd1173e3e
confirmations
154637
spent
true